The prominent Italian political scientist Norberto Bobbio (1909-2004) wrote a very interesting book about the forms of government in the history of political thought (Bobbio, 1992), in that book he begins with a "famous discussion" between three Persian characters: Otanes, Megabyzo and Dario, about what should be the best form of government to be established in Persia. Otanes is the defender of the government of many (democracy), Megabyzo defends the government of a few (aristocracy) and Dario defends the government of one (monarchy), Otanes democracy is the only form of government that guarantees equality before the law. The process of preparing the population policy is a commitment assumed by the Peruvian State through international agreements and treaties of which it is a part. Based on these, the State, in order to apply an appropriate public population policy, must plan and execute public actions regarding the dynamics, structure, volume and distribution of the population over the national territory. In that sense, this policy occurs within a broader framework in favor of socio-economic development and not in isolation. In this study we reflect on the background of the Peruvian Population Policy, the current population policy law and the main elements of the National Population Plan 2010-2014 (the same one that is currently in force).
